    Notebook: Spurs finish 'toughest' month
    Mike Monroe
    Express-News

    When the most difficult month of the Spurs season began, they were seven games into their longest win streak of the season and first in the Western Conference.

    By the time their own version of March madness — 18 games in 30 days — ended with a victory over the Houston Rockets at the AT&T Center on Sunday, they had endured their longest losing streak since 2003, slipped to as low as sixth in the West and finally clawed their way back to the top of the Western standings.

    Despite losing six of seven games in a 10-day, mid-month stretch, they won 12 of the 18 games, a 66.7 percent win percentage not far off their season-long figure.

    "It was the toughest month we've ever had," Spurs coach Gregg Popovich said, "and we survived. We lost a few more than we normally lose in March, but I think we got pretty good health and good energy and I think we got better in the month. That's the important part."

    Some of the Spurs, in fact, believe they may look back on the month as the most valuable of the season.

    "Even through the losses, through the adverse situations, I think we grew as a team," forward Michael Finley said. "Hopefully, down the line in the regular season and the playoffs, we'll look at situations in which we learned in March that can help us get a win."

    Bruce Bowen's consecutive games played streak ended at 500 during March when he was suspended by the league for what it determined was a kick aimed at New Orleans' Chris Paul. Despite that personal setback, he said the tough schedule benefited the Spurs by reminding them to pay attention to detail.

    "You understand you're not that far off the mark," he said. "Maybe it's paying more attention to detail. Maybe it's playing the full 48, instead of 40 minutes. In those situations, you just stick to what's important, and sometimes that's the little things."


    He's safe!

    Bowen seemed to enjoy Sunday's blowout victory more than most. He joked with the crowd, and even with referee Bennie Adams.

    Knocked on his belly by Rockets forward Shane Battier midway through the fourth period, Bowen slid several feet across the court, breaking up fans seated nearby by giving a baseball "safe" sign.

    "I enjoy doing stuff like that," he said. "Maybe they'll go back home and tell their friends, 'That was pretty funny when Bruce said he needed to get a timeout from the third-base coach.'"

    Moments later, Battier knocked Bowen down again, this time as Bowen attempted a 3-point shot in the corner. No foul was called, and Bowen chided Adams, but with a laugh.

    "Sometimes you have to joke with the refs a little," he said.
